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
An Outline of Metal Polishing - Mostly, metal finishing is required for aesthetics and for clean-room usage. It really is one of the more prominent methods for its effectiveness in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the product, such as, cookware, motor vehicle parts or motor bike parts. What's more, a lot of clean-rooms desire a lustrous finish as a way to minimize the penetrability of the metal surfaces which can cause dirt to collect and contaminate. A good instance of this usage could be in vacuum chambers. There exist a number of approaches to polish metals, and we'll consider some of the procedures required. Metal may be finished by hand,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A particular polishing paste or compound is regularly utilised, that could incorporate a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, due to its mediocre th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scidity, and hardness is normally one of the most time intensive. In contrast, items produced from non-ferrous metal tend to be amenable to buffing, because these need the lower amount of treatments.
Any time a greater processing quality is simply not essential, swifter pad speeds may be employed. A lesser pad speed can be used any time a superior mirror finish is important. Polishing buffs bedaubed in compound will be very much impacted by the forces on the surface of the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ure could be increased within certain levels, though going above the optimal level of load not only minimizes the quality level of the process, but also degrades efficiency, might lead to wear on the part, and there's moreover an apparent overheating of the pieces being worked on, generated by friction. With thin material, it's greater heat (and the resultant pliability of the material) that will frequently cause items to distort, buckle or warp. In most cases, it requires an educated technician to take into account each one of these things to equally avoid harm to the workpiece and to operate effectively. For you to appreciably boost the quality of the completed finish, the buffing procedure will have to be done with less aggression and not as much pressure to be able to in due course complete a surface area that doesn't have any scores or marks which result from the finishing process, thus ar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
